Dr. Martin Luther King Jr.’s “Three Evils of Society” PDF

On August 31, 1967, Dr. Martin Luther King Jr. gave the following speech at the National Conference on New Politics. In it, he identifies three connected evils of society: racism, materialism (i.e. capitalism), and militarism. Dr. King’s analysis in this speech evinces his move toward a more radical, socialistic politics, and counters the sanitized, liberal image of Dr. King often purveyed today.
